FIELD: technological processes.;SUBSTANCE: invention relates to the field of polymer processing, more specifically to the research and optimization of molding conditions of products made of polymeric composite materials (PCM) manufactured using technology such as RTM (ResinToolMolding), LRI (LiquidResinInfusion), RFI (ResinFilmInfusion), more specifically to the researches of steeping of a tissue sample previously laid in closed cavity of measuring cell of device (bench) for studying kinetics of steeping of tissues with various structures and chemical nature in conditions of dampening and filtration. Proposed device for studying the kinetics of steeping of tissue samples with liquid polymer binders consists of a reservoir with a liquid binder, a device for dipping study sample with a binder and a compressor to create pressure when giving the binder. Device for dipping is a horizontal tube with tappeds made of transparent material; one end of the tube is connected to a reservoir with liquid binder for dipping under pressure, and at the same end of the bend of the tube a gas tank is installed to input gas bubble into the binder in the tube; to control the pressure that determines motion speed of the binder in the tube, pressure detector is connected, and to determine the motion speed of the binder in the dipping device, a device for video fixing is installed, with reference to real time of movement of gas bubble in the binder; in all branches of the tube to indicated compressor, reservoir with binder, gas tank, manometer, stopcocks are installed. In this case, to steep filler with the binder a measuring cell for a sample of tissue to be examined is placed between located in front transparent capillary tube and a catch tank for bleedout; measuring cell is a construction of two rectangular metal die plates and punch with fluoroplastic jacket with air proof plain rectangular slot between them for placing in it a tissue sample with the possibility of its external compression by punch; insertion holes into air proof slot of the cell of liquid polymer binder and output of its surplus are located lateral on the opposite sides of plates and they are equipped with connection to join external tubes. Device allows to adjust the width of front of the binder flow by changing the location along periphery of the tissue sample of the compaction elements guiding the binder into sample. Proposed device allows to conduct studies of the kinetics of dipping of tissue samples of various braidings with liquid polymer binders under conditions of different pressure of binder injection.;EFFECT: obtained results can be used to select conditions of dipping and to calculate the strength of polymer composite die mold during its planning.;1 cl, 4 dwg
